HKK Siroki Brijeg (Division I) landed 26-year old Croatian 208cm forward Luka Barisic (college: W.Illinois) for new season. Barisic played most recently at Ilirija in Slovenian Liga Nova KBM. In 28 games he averaged 12.1ppg, 4.6rpg and 2.0apg last season. He can count that year as a very successful as was voted to Eurobasket.com All-Slovenian League Honorable Mention and League Player of the Week (2 times). Barisic also played 8 games in Alpe Adria Cup where he had 12.3ppg, 4.1rpg and 2.0apg.
The previous (2022-23) season he played at BC DepoLink Skrljevo in Croatian Premijer Liga. In 26 games he recorded 13.0ppg, 4.9rpg and 1.0apg in that year. He also played 4 games in Alpe Adria Cup where he got 13.3ppg, 3.0rpg and 1.5apg in that year. The other team he played shortly was KK Podgorica Bemax in Montenegrin league. In two ABA League games he got 7.5ppg, 2.5rpg, 2.0apg and 1.0spg in that year. Barisic also played 2 games in Montenegrin Erste Liga where he got 4.5ppg and 4.5rpg in that year.
He represented Croatia at the European Championship (FIBA EuroBasket) U18 in Samsun (Turkey) eight years ago. His stats at that event were 6 games: 3.3ppg, 2.0rpg, 1.2apg.
Barisic won NJCAA D1 Region 4 championship title in 2018.
He graduated from Western Illinois University in 2022 and it will be his third season in pro basketball. Barisic played for other colleges like: The University of Texas San Antonio, Highland Community College, Illinois.
